Shin (Li Xin) and his newly christened Hishin Unit taste initial success on the battlefield, managing to push back early waves of Zhao forces. However, the tide changes dramatically when a colossal, mysterious warrior named Hou Ken descends upon their camp under the cover of night. Revealing himself as one of Zhao's supreme figureheads, Hou Ken effortlessly cuts through Qin soldiers. Even with Kyou Kai (Qiang Lei) utilizing her mystical, deep-trance swordsmanship, the physical disparity is too vast.
